    Unlock the power of storytelling to inspire, engage, and motivate. In this dynamic two-part masterclass, nonprofit leaders will explore how to craft stories that connect with audiences and effectively communicate their mission.

    The first part is a 60-minute live virtual session, where participants will learn essential storytelling foundations, including key story structures, types, and visual storytelling strategies. 

    Key Takeaways: 

    • Understand why storytelling is a powerful tool for influence and engagement 
    • Learn key story types and structures that resonate with diverse audiences 
    • Discover visual storytelling strategies to enhance your message 
    • Develop and refine a personal or organizational story to build connection and drive action 

    Join us for this engaging masterclass and walk away with a clear, compelling story to elevate your organization’s impact and communicate with confidence!

    imageMeet Our Speaker: Ashley Bright, The Message Fixer

    Ashley Bright is The Message Fixer. 

    Clients hire him to bring clarity, boldness, and impact to their communication. 

    Drawing on his experience as a Creative Director who presented to companies like Apple, Target, and AT&T, he leverages storytelling and empathy to break through resistance and challenge the status quo. 

    Organizations such as United Way, Social Venture Partners, Arizona State University, TED Conferences, HonorHealth, and the American Advertising Federation rely on his IMPACT Speaking Method to transform communication, build influence, and drive meaningful change. 

    Ashley has delivered impactful talks at Sanford Institute of Philanthropy, DisruptHR, Kimberly-Clark Global Leadership Summit, Phoenix Startup Week, and WeWork, inspiring audiences to elevate their communication and leadership skills.

    Did you know that your audience can be some of your most powerful fundraisers? Arizona Gives Day provides a great opportunity to ask your audience to get their friends and family involved in your mission! Using the peer-to-peer fundraising tools on AZGives.org, we’ll help you think through a strategy to turn your current supporters from donors to fundraisers and advocates.

    Highlights: 

    • Using the peer-to-peer fundraising tools on Mightycause 
    • How to use peer-to-peer strategies during AZ Gives Day 
    • How to equip your audience to advocate on your behalf, including examples of successful peer-to-peer campaigns

    This session will be hosted by GiveMN, a seasoned leader in giving day management and consulting. As the driving force behind their own successful giving day, GiveMN brings unparalleled expertise and insights to help you maximize your AZ Gives Day experience.

    imageMeet our Speaker:

    Courtney Backen, GiveMN

    Courtney Backen (she/her) is the Senior Director of Community Impact at GiveMN, the host of one of the country's first and largest nonprofit giving days, Give to the Max Day (GTMD). As the GTMD project lead, she oversees giving day strategy development and implementation with a specialized focus on capacity building and training for nonprofits and schools. In 2024, Courtney completed the thirteenth giving day of her career and believes that giving days help to shine a light on all nonprofits and are opportunities for celebration and creativity in fundraising.

    In the last century, LGBTQ+ people have fought for rights in the United States. Though LGBTQ+ people have been at the forefront of every major civil rights struggle, their stories are not often told. In this training, we will learn about the landmark stories and cases that led us to our current state. We will then touch on some best practices to create more inclusive and affirming spaces for LGBTQ+ folks. Participants will walk away with a more nuanced understanding of LGBTQ+ history as well as the beginnings of actions they can take toward equity and inclusion. 

    Key Takeaways: 

    • The Evolution of Anti-LGBTQ+ Legislation Explore the progression of laws and policies that have marginalized the LGBTQ+ community, both historically and in modern times, and understand their ongoing impact on society.
    • Key Legal Milestones in LGBTQ+ Rights Examine significant legal victories that have shaped the fight for LGBTQ+ rights, highlighting pivotal moments in the journey toward equality.
    • Strategies for Building Inclusive and Affirming Spaces Learn essential practices and approaches that can help organizations create more inclusive, equitable, and supportive environments for LGBTQ+ individuals and communities.

    Are you curious about how Arizona lawmakers might shape the future of your cause or organization? Join Brandy Petrone, Senior Associate at Goodman Schwartz Public Affairs, for an insider’s look at the 2025 legislative session. Brandy will provide an overview of the key policy issues dominating the state Capitol and offer insights into the key figures influencing decisions, from Governor Katie Hobbs to legislative leaders and influential advocates. She will break down the complex legislative process and highlight important bills and state budget priorities that could impact the nonprofit and philanthropic sectors. This session will arm you with the knowledge needed to navigate the political landscape and advocate effectively for your mission. 

    Key Takeaways: 

    • Understand the major issues and bills to watch in the 2025 Arizona legislative session. 
    • Learn about the key figures driving policy decisions in Arizona’s state government. 
    • Gain practical insights on how to advocate for your cause and influence state-level policy. 
    • Discover the budget priorities that could impact nonprofits and philanthropy in Arizona.
